The National Institutes of Health (NIH), the nation’s medical research agency and the leading supporter of biomedical research in the world, said all of its clinical programs will be effected by $1.55 billion in NIH budget cuts due to sequestration. On March 1, 2013, as required by statute, President Obama signed an order initiating sequestration. This requires NIH to cut 5 percent, or $1.55 billion, of its fiscal year (FY) 2013 budget. NIH must apply the cut evenly across all programs, projects and activities (PPAs), which are primarily NIH institutes and centers.

Highly educated individuals with mild cognitive impairment that later progressed to Alzheimer’s disease cope better with the disease than individuals with a lower level of education in the same situation, according to research published in The Journal of Nuclear Medicine. In the study, “Metabolic Networks Underlying Cognitive Reserve in Prodromal Alzheimer Disease: A European Alzheimer Disease Consortium Project,” neural reserve and neural compensation were both shown to play a role in determining cognitive reserve, as evidenced by positron emission tomography (PET).

Siemens Healthcare has announced that the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) recently cleared the company’s CAIPIRINHA (Controlled Aliasing in Volumetric Parallel Imaging Results IN Higher Acceleration) software as part of Siemens’ syngo MR D13A software package for parallel magnetic resonance (MR) imaging. The software helps enable patients with breath-holding difficulties to reduce the amount of time they hold their breath by up to 50 percent without sacrificing imaging resolution or contrast.
